1. Bangalore – Innovation & Technology Capital

Bangalore consistently ranks among the top 5 cities in India for higher education because of its thriving IT ecosystem and global exposure. Students here benefit from strong industry integration and startup opportunities.

Key Advantages:

  • Direct access to multinational companies
  • Internship-rich environment
  • Entrepreneurial ecosystem
  • Diverse student population

As a result, engineering, management, law, and liberal arts students gain practical exposure alongside academics.

2. Pune – Academic Excellence with Balance

Pune blends tradition with modern education. Because of its student-friendly atmosphere, it remains one of the most preferred destinations.

Why Students Choose Pune:

  • Moderate cost of living
  • Cultural festivals and academic seminars
  • Safe and peaceful environment
  • Strong alumni networks

Therefore, students seeking balanced academic and personal growth find Pune highly suitable.

3. Hyderabad – Emerging Tech & Research Hub

Hyderabad has transformed into a leading IT and business center. Consequently, students pursuing technology and management programs experience strong placement growth.

Major Highlights:

  • Expanding corporate parks
  • Competitive fee structures
  • Industry-oriented curriculum
  • Growing startup culture

Moreover, the city offers a mix of heritage and modern infrastructure, making student life comfortable.

4. Delhi NCR – Exposure to Policy & Corporate Ecosystem

Delhi NCR provides unmatched exposure to policy-making institutions and multinational companies. Because of this, students interested in law, governance, management, and media gain strong internship opportunities.

Core Benefits:

  • National-level networking
  • Corporate headquarters access
  • Internship-driven learning
  • Diverse academic community

Hence, Delhi NCR offers both academic depth and professional acceleration.

5. Mumbai – Financial & Media Capital

Mumbai remains a top destination for ambitious students. Since it houses major financial institutions and media networks, it creates strong career pathways.

Why Mumbai Stands Out:

  • Corporate internships
  • Finance and banking exposure
  • Media and entertainment industry access
  • Strong placement ecosystem

Therefore, students aiming for finance, marketing, or entrepreneurship thrive in this competitive environment.

Frequently Asked Questions

1. Which is the best city among the top 5 cities in India for higher education?

Each city has strengths. Bangalore suits tech students, Mumbai favors finance aspirants, while Pune offers balanced academic growth.

2. Are living costs high in these education hubs?

Costs vary. Pune and Hyderabad are comparatively affordable, whereas Mumbai and Delhi NCR may require higher budgeting.

3. Do these cities offer good placement opportunities?

Yes. Because these cities host major industries, they provide strong internship and placement support.

4. How important is industry presence while choosing a city?

Industry presence directly influences internship access, networking, and campus recruitment opportunities.
